Where to stay in Chinatown

Find the best Chinatown areas and neighborhoods for the activities you enjoy most. Learn more about Chinatown
Learn more about Chinatown

Downtown Vancouver

Central business district meets diverse neighborhoods, featuring high-rise apartments, Granville Mall, Gastown Steam Clock, and Sun Tower. Easily accessible via SkyTrain, SeaBus, and water taxis.

West Side

While you're in West Side, take in top sights like VanDusen Botanical Garden or Kitsilano Beach, and hop on the metro to see more the city at King Edward Station or Oakridge-41st Avenue Station.

West End

Fashionable Robson Street offers shopping and dining, while parks and beaches like Stanley Park and Sunset Beach provide outdoor activities. Explore the Stanley Park Seawall promenade and enjoy amenities along Denman and Davie Streets.

East Vancouver

If you're spending time in East Vancouver, check out sights like Port of Vancouver or Commercial Drive and hop on the metro to see more the city at Nanaimo Station or 29th Avenue Station.

Kitsilano

Ethnic food, fashionable shops and one of Vancouver’s best beaches are all part of this bayside neighborhood.

Best time to go to Chinatown

The best time to visit Chinatown can depend on the weather and when visitor numbers rise and fall. The hottest average temperature around Chinatown falls in August, when visitor numbers are slightly high and weather is mostly sunny with light rain. The coolest average temperature around Chinatown falls in December, visitor numbers are average and weather is mostly cloudy with frequent rain.

calendarCalendar MonthtemperatureTemperaturerainPrecipitationmostlyCloudinessoccupationOccupancypricePricing
January38.3°F (3.5°C)Frequent RainMostly CloudySlightly LowSlightly Low
February37.8°F (3.2°C)Moderate RainMostly CloudySlightly LowSlightly Low
March41.5°F (5.3°C)Moderate RainMostly CloudyAverageAverage
April46.4°F (8.0°C)Light RainMostly CloudyAverageAverage
May54.3°F (12.4°C)Light RainMostly SunnyAverageAverage
June59.2°F (15.1°C)Light RainMostly SunnyAverageSlightly High
July64.9°F (18.3°C)No RainMostly SunnySlightly HighSlightly High
August65.3°F (18.5°C)Light RainMostly SunnySlightly HighSlightly High
September59.4°F (15.2°C)Light RainMostly SunnySlightly HighAverage
October50.9°F (10.5°C)Moderate RainMostly SunnyAverageAverage
November42.6°F (5.9°C)Frequent RainMostly CloudySlightly LowSlightly Low
December37.2°F (2.9°C)Frequent RainMostly CloudyAverageAverage
